Patrik Nordwall
05ba6df5ac
Merge pull request #1424 from akka/wip-3326-connection-retries-patriknw
...
Connection retries to shutdown node, see #3326
2013-05-14 11:19:09 -07:00
Patrik Nordwall
3d1c0a7325
Connection retries to shutdown node, see #3326
...
* In EC2 connection time out is around 1 minute. A few messages
were sent after quarantining and these caused endless restarts,
and connect attempts with 1 minute interval.
* This change makes sure that the endpoint is stopped after the first
failed connection attempt.
* Changed default settings for netty connection-timeout, and matching
retry window to allow for 3 restarts
2013-05-13 17:09:30 +02:00
Patrik Nordwall
d0ed7385b2
Merge pull request #1420 from akka/wip-3296-pub-metrics-patriknw
...
Publish cluster metrics periodically, see #3296
2013-05-13 06:02:32 -07:00
Mathias
b0b3f3ae38
io: add comments based on review feedback
2013-05-13 14:14:49 +02:00
Mathias
0e0a95ff95
io: remove SelectionKey lookup and reduce IO-layer-internal message volume
2013-05-13 14:14:49 +02:00
Mathias
bc66aa97c6
io: small clean-ups
2013-05-13 14:14:49 +02:00
Mathias
8070d4cfd3
io-tests: simplify TcpConnectionSpec in preparation for coming modifications
...
This doesn't change any test logic, it merely structures the test fixture code a bit differently to make it easier to insert additional mocks required for coming additions.
2013-05-13 14:14:49 +02:00
Endre Sándor Varga
311799bd24
Heartbeat interval was too low compared to awaitCond sampling #3289
2013-05-13 14:14:49 +02:00
Roland Kuhn
e928fd87f4
Merge pull request #1435 from akka/wip-upgrade-scalabuff-to-1.2.0-ban
...
Upgrade ScalaBuff to 1.2.0
2013-05-13 00:02:11 -07:00
Björn Antonsson
75e0321d0f
Upgrade ScalaBuff to 1.2.0
2013-05-13 07:47:19 +02:00
Viktor Klang (√)
86e9326940
Merge pull request #1419 from akka/wip-3322-generating-unique-name-for-big-bounce-√
...
#3322 - Changing the name of the bigBounce actor in RemotingSpec to a u...
2013-05-11 10:02:19 -07:00
Patrik Nordwall
659cd8aaa5
Merge pull request #1421 from akka/wip-3285-lost-welcome-patriknw
...
Better test timeouts in UnreachableNodeJoinsAgainSpec, see #3285
2013-05-10 11:54:36 -07:00
Viktor Klang (√)
3578c95e7f
Merge pull request #1425 from akka/wip-javac-utf-8-√
...
#3333 - adding -encoding UTF-8 to javacOptions
2013-05-10 05:01:38 -07:00
Viktor Klang (√)
e73cc01b94
Merge pull request #1426 from akka/wip-3313-ConsumerIntegrationTest-timing-sensitive-√
...
#3313 - Relaxing the timing of the consumer timeout and marking the tes...
2013-05-10 05:01:11 -07:00
Roland Kuhn
a5c9147dcc
Merge pull request #1423 from akka/wip-future-docs-∂π
...
add Futures.promise to the docs
2013-05-10 04:46:45 -07:00
Roland Kuhn
96aac98093
Merge pull request #1417 from akka/wip-genjavadoc0.5-∂π
...
update to genjavadoc 0.5
2013-05-10 04:46:11 -07:00
Roland Kuhn
6b8eda2013
Merge pull request #1411 from akka/wip-3274-FSM.next-∂π
...
clear FSM.nextState after transition, see #3274
2013-05-10 04:45:58 -07:00
Viktor Klang
f049ea4892
#3313 - Relaxing the timing of the consumer timeout and marking the test as timing sensitive.
2013-05-10 02:34:12 +02:00
Viktor Klang
ab1b259e1a
#3333 - adding -encoding UTF-8 to javacOptions
2013-05-10 02:30:45 +02:00
Roland
e6655ec157
add Futures.promise to the docs
2013-05-09 21:50:28 +02:00
Patrik Nordwall
9ec0b7ca71
Better test timeouts in UnreachableNodeJoinsAgainSpec, see #3285
2013-05-09 21:27:23 +02:00
Patrik Nordwall
ace0c53a6f
Publish cluster metrics periodically, see #3296
...
* instead of when it receives metrics gossip and when it collects metrics
2013-05-09 20:54:46 +02:00
Viktor Klang
a4bce44dce
#3322 - Changing the name of the bigBounce actor in RemotingSpec to a unique one so that there is no race between tests.
2013-05-09 20:43:06 +02:00
Roland Kuhn
325ea283cb
Merge pull request #1410 from akka/wip-3320-to-many-threads-again-ban
...
Some more test cleanup to not create so many threads #3320
2013-05-09 00:56:05 -07:00
Roland
9842980e25
update to genjavadoc 0.5
2013-05-09 09:41:35 +02:00
Björn Antonsson
9c5cc24ba7
Some more test cleanup to not create so many threads. See #3320
2013-05-08 12:42:15 +02:00
Roland
59bec8eb31
clear FSM.nextState after transition, see #3274
2013-05-08 10:12:47 +02:00
Roland Kuhn
e02bdeb84b
Merge pull request #1402 from CodeBlock/deadlinks
...
Fix 3 dead links to a paper. (More docs fixes)
2013-05-08 01:07:19 -07:00
Ricky Elrod
324630ab9a
Fix 3 dead links to a paper in akka-docs.
...
Make them point to an Akka mirror of the paper instead.
2013-05-08 03:57:37 -04:00
Roland Kuhn
dbe0ef0acd
Merge pull request #1409 from akka/wip-3317-awaitAssert-∂π
...
fix TestTimeSpec, see #3317
2013-05-07 11:57:22 -07:00
drewhk
088f1019d7
Merge pull request #1408 from drewhk/wip-selector-wakeup-miss-drewhk
...
Fixed race causing missed wakeups
2013-05-07 11:43:32 -07:00
drewhk
27c70a3f69
Removed unnecessary comment
2013-05-07 21:42:36 +03:00
Roland
f626f1d719
fix TestTimeSpec, see #3317
2013-05-07 20:02:59 +02:00
Endre Sándor Varga
b055ba967b
Fixed race causing missed wakeups
2013-05-07 18:38:54 +02:00
Patrik Nordwall
236330f3c6
Merge pull request #1401 from akka/wip-3265-heartbeating-race2-patriknw
...
Changed design of RemoteWatcher due to cleanup race, see #3265
2013-05-07 04:27:26 -07:00
Björn Antonsson
14faef8355
Merge pull request #1404 from akka/wip-3311-localactorrefproviderspec-failure-ban
...
Actor fields are cleared after Terminated is sent #3311
2013-05-07 03:32:51 -07:00
drewhk
af872086c5
Merge pull request #1405 from drewhk/wip-3315-typedprops-deploy-drewhk
...
TypedProps now uses deploy information #3315
2013-05-07 02:54:53 -07:00
Endre Sándor Varga
158a921ea9
TypedProps now uses deploy information #3315
2013-05-07 11:53:10 +02:00
drewhk
cc38f7d95a
Merge pull request #1403 from drewhk/wip-3306-fragmented-delimiter-drewhk
...
Fixed decoding in the case of fragmented delimiters #3306
2013-05-07 02:49:31 -07:00
Endre Sándor Varga
3209e38d9d
Fixed decoding in the case of fragmented delimiters #3306
...
- also improved tests
2013-05-07 11:43:48 +02:00
Björn Antonsson
aec8326308
Actor fields are cleared after Terminated is sent. See #3311
2013-05-07 11:10:05 +02:00
Björn Antonsson
ddade2c59e
Merge pull request #1395 from akka/wip-3217-remotedeathwatchspec-failure-ban
...
Wait on shutdown of extra actor systems in tests. #3217
2013-05-07 02:03:05 -07:00
Björn Antonsson
e00ab533bb
Wait on shutdown of extra actor systems in tests. See #3217
2013-05-07 11:02:03 +02:00
Patrik Nordwall
257313ce2a
Merge pull request #1385 from akka/wip-3280-log-payload-size-patriknw
...
Logging of the size of different message types.
2013-05-07 01:05:03 -07:00
Roland Kuhn
3bc661bed6
Merge pull request #1396 from akka/wip-3293-remove-single-arg-tell-∂π
...
remove ActorRef#tell(Any), see #3293
2013-05-06 04:25:03 -07:00
Patrik Nordwall
7628889b43
Changed design of RemoteWatcher due to cleanup race, see #3265
...
* The problem was a race caused by HeartbeatReq sent out, and
the watchee terminated immediately. That caused the RemoteWatcher
peers watching each other without any other watch registered.
It is racy.
* Instead of one-way heartbeats from the side beeing watched I
changed to ping-pong style. That makes the problem go away
and simplifies a lot of things in RemoteWatcher.
2013-05-04 17:35:12 +02:00
Roland Kuhn
cb6ba83f38
Merge pull request #1389 from akka/wip-3287-actorSelection-∂π
...
ActorSelection: equals/hashCode and “ask”
2013-05-03 14:49:15 -07:00
Roland
ddf2117ed7
remove ActorRef#tell(Any), see #3293
...
also remove FakeActorRef from SerCompSpec
2013-05-03 21:39:29 +02:00
Roland Kuhn
c84bbea4aa
Merge pull request #1400 from akka/wip-3307-prepare-EC-∂π
...
call executor.prepare() for scheduled jobs, see #3307
2013-05-03 12:11:51 -07:00
Roland
b3db19ee05
Merge branch 'wip-3281-NullMessage-∂π'
2013-05-03 19:40:36 +02:00